Hi all. I have been fortunate enough to inherit 2 Triumphs owned by my uncle. They are a 1955 Trophy TR5 and a 1970 T120RT. In addition to the bikes I was also handed a large box of papers which include personal notes about the bikes (any service work done or modifications), receipts, telegraphs and a number of original manuals and parts books. They were both ridden, the 55 has a few battle scars from several trips to Baja but the 70 looks pretty clean and the odometer says 40K. Im under the impression the bikes havent been started in about 5 years. My uncle was bed ridden for quite some time and the license tags are several years old. They both need to be rebuilt but this will be done with a lot of care and consideration for a minimalist approach. So now its up to me to get these things moving again with a goal of getting them into a show, Im giving myself 2 years. My experience with motorcycle builds.. none. My work on bikes is pretty minimal but Im pretty mechanically inclined. I will however have a lot of help so Im not concerned, really more excited about the journey and what Ill learn. Since these are my first Triumphs Im looking for help finding great Triumph forums. I also need a couple sites where I might find parts. Any help would be appreciated. I will post more photos as I move through the process of the builds. Im also planning on documenting the builds though photography and write ups so they can become part of the bikes histories.
